利用混淆矩阵及Kappa系数评价土地利用分类精度

利用混淆矩阵及Kappa系数评价土地利用分类精度文章目录一 准备工作二 处理步骤 2 1Arcmap 栅格转点 多值提取到点栅格转点多值提取至点 2 2Excel 计算混淆矩阵三 Excel 计算模板下载地址一 准备工作 土地利用类型参考栅格和预测栅格 tif 需要保证两者的投影坐标系和像元大小一致 用户精度 useraccuracy 生产者精度 produceraccu 总精度 overallaccur 的计算原理 kappa 系数计算可以参考这一篇 Kappa 系数 则对于上文中的例子来说 有软件需要用到 A


一、准备工作

  • 土地利用类型参考栅格和预测栅格(.tif)
    需要保证两者的投影坐标系和像元大小一致
    在这里插入图片描述

  • 用户精度(user accuracy),生产者精度(producer accuracy)、总精度(overall accuracy)的计算原理
    在这里插入图片描述
  • kappa系数计算
    可以参考这一篇Kappa系数。则对于上文中的例子来说,有
    在这里插入图片描述

  • 软件需要用到Arcmap和Excel

二、处理步骤

2.1 Arcmap:栅格转点+多值提取到点

栅格转点

多值提取至点

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

2.2 Excel:计算混淆矩阵

在这里插入图片描述
创建数据透视表
在这里插入图片描述
设置数据透视表字段列表,列标签为参考栅格对应的列,行标签为预测栅格对应的列,数值选择”FID”和“POINTID”均可,但需要右键将值字段设置中的值汇总方式更改为计数
在这里插入图片描述
在这里插入图片描述
遇到这种预测栅格的可选值(1、3、4、5)小于参考栅格的情况,需要手动补全缺失分类项
在这里插入图片描述
利用Excel中的函数功能来计算混淆矩阵,可以得到下表
在这里插入图片描述









三、Excel计算模板下载地址

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/223945.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月17日 下午1:04
下一篇 2026年3月17日 下午1:04


相关推荐

  • java过滤器怎么使用(过滤器滤纸怎么配置)

    过滤器的作用:用于过滤请求,在请求发出前后,做一些检查或操作,配置及使用步骤如下:1.要配置Filter,首先建立一个Java类,实现Filter接口,代码如下importjava.io.IOException;importjavax.servlet.Filter;importjavax.servlet.FilterChain;importjavax.servl

    2022年4月12日
    142
  • keytool条目_keytool的笔记

    keytool条目_keytool的笔记1 1 Keytool 是一个有效的安全钥匙和证书的管理工具 Java 中的 keytool exe 位于 JDK Bin 目录下 可以用来创建数字证书 所有的数字证书是以一条一条 采用别名区别 的形式存入证书库的中 证书库中的一条证书包含该条证书的私钥 公钥和对应的数字证书的信息 证书库中的一条证书可以导出数字证书文件 数字证书文件只包括主体信息和对应的公钥 Keytool 把钥匙和证书储存到

    2026年3月18日
    1
  • 基于mips内核的Atheros芯片–wlan中的VAP的创建「建议收藏」

    基于mips内核的Atheros芯片–wlan中的VAP的创建「建议收藏」重要是使用命令创建,可以通过无线网卡和手机登陆的无线网络标识。登陆名称就是ssid号。1:/etc/rc.d/rc.wlanup//这个文件主要用来加载wlan相应的驱动程序。2:配置ip地址,针对br0。ifconfigbr010.10.99.194up  3:创建基本的VAP/etc/rc.d/rc.wlanupwlanconfigath0creat

    2025年6月9日
    7
  • 基于单片机超声波测距系统的设计_单片机类毕业设计

    基于单片机超声波测距系统的设计_单片机类毕业设计Hi,大家好,这里是丹成学长,今天向大家介绍一个超级炫酷的单片机项目,非常适合用于毕设基于单片机的超声波雷达设计大家可用于课程设计或毕业设计1、绘制雷达表盘2、增加扫描线3、实现拖影效果4、实现目标扫描点显示(渐出效果)1、准备器材(arduinoUNO、360度舵机、超声波传感器、扩展板)2、雷达平台1、串口通讯接受数据2、扫描点的显示函数改造超声波检测原理线电波(微波)从雷达发射到自由空间,其中一些波被反射物体拦截,并从不同的方向上进行反射。这些波中一些波会引回雷达,被雷达接受并且

    2025年11月1日
    3
  • 培根密码加解密_二进制密码在线解密

    培根密码加解密_二进制密码在线解密0x00介绍培根密码实际上就是一种替换密码,根据所给表一一对应转换即可加密解密它的特殊之处在于:可以通过不明显的特征来隐藏密码信息,比如大小写、正斜体等,只要两个不同的属性,密码即可隐藏0x01代码实现脚本很简单,就是建立对应关系,对密文,或者明文进行相应的替换即可需要注意的是输入的都应该是全小写字母或全大写字母,在脚本里也有说明python脚本如下:#…

    2025年7月27日
    5
  • 解决springboot 2.0集成elasticsearch 7.6.2 查询总数为10000

    解决springboot 2.0集成elasticsearch 7.6.2 查询总数为10000小伙伴们,你们好,我是老寇据查询相关资料,在elasticsearch7.x以后的版本,当查询的结果总数大于1万时,默认total返回总数为10000在kibana获取真实总数,只需要加添加track_total_hits参数{“query”:{“match_all”:{}},”track_total_hits”:true}在springboot项目中,增加配置//获取真实总数searchSourceBuilder.trackTotalHit

    2022年5月25日
    44

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号